Coral is an animal. Contrary to what one might think, coral is neither a plant nor a mineral. It is an animal belonging to the branch of Cnidarians. Corals, which generally live in colonies, build an external skeleton throughout their lives from minerals present in the ocean. In reef-building cor ...
